Rate Index · August 2019

Auto loan rates in August 2019.

Average advertised APRs across the U.S. lenders we track. Advertised rates assume top-tier credit - treat them as each lender's floor. Methodology.

New car
4.24%
+0.03 pts vs July 2019
Lowest: 2.49% (PenFed Credit Union)
Used car
4.46%
+0.03 pts vs July 2019
Lowest: 3.14% (Bank of America)
Refinance
4.42%
+0.10 pts vs July 2019
Lowest: 3.74% (Bank of America)
Lease buyout
5.15%
-0.08 pts vs July 2019
Lowest: 3.94% (Bank of America)

New car - by lender

LenderAvg advertised APR (August 2019)Lowest seen
Bank of America 3.20% 2.94%
PenFed Credit Union 3.59% 2.49%
U.S. Bank 4.59% 4.59%
Truist 4.64% 3.99%
Chase 5.18% 5.04%

Used car - by lender

LenderAvg advertised APR (August 2019)Lowest seen
Bank of America 3.43% 3.14%
PenFed Credit Union 4.00% 3.49%
U.S. Bank 4.59% 4.59%
Truist 4.64% 3.99%
Chase 5.65% 5.49%

Refinance - by lender

LenderAvg advertised APR (August 2019)Lowest seen
Bank of America 4.03% 3.74%
U.S. Bank 4.59% 4.59%
Truist 4.64% 3.99%

Lease buyout - by lender

LenderAvg advertised APR (August 2019)Lowest seen
Bank of America 4.25% 3.94%
Truist 6.05% 4.99%

How to read these numbers

Every figure on this page is an average of advertised APRs - the rates lenders publish for their best-qualified borrowers on the shortest common terms. Your own offer depends on credit profile, term length, vehicle age, and state. Two practical uses:
